
Troy Vincent
Troy Vincent is a former NFL player and current executive who serves as the NFL's Executive Vice President of Football Operations. He is known for his commitment to player safety and has been instrumental in various initiatives aimed at improving the health and safety of players in the league. Recently, he has been involved in discussions regarding the controversial 'Tush Push' play, which some teams, including the Green Bay Packers, are seeking to ban.
